Android开发效能跃升:区块链工具链赋能建站资源整合
|
Android开发长期面临资源分散、协作低效、版本混乱等痛点。设计师交付的切图常与开发环境不匹配,UI组件库更新滞后,第三方SDK集成缺乏统一校验,甚至同一项目中多个团队并行开发时,资源哈希值不一致导致线上样式错乱。这些问题并非技术能力不足所致,而是建站级资源整合机制缺失——资源从设计到部署的全链路缺乏可信锚点与自动化协同能力。 区块链工具链并非用于替代传统构建系统,而是作为“可信中间件”嵌入现有流程。它不存储大文件,仅将资源元数据(如图片SHA-256哈希、组件版本号、依赖声明、发布者数字签名)上链存证。当设计师上传Figma导出的@2x/@3x切图至内部资源平台时,工具自动计算哈希并广播至轻量级联盟链节点;Android工程在Gradle sync阶段调用链上API校验资源指纹,若本地文件哈希与链上记录不符,则立即阻断构建并提示“资源被篡改或未同步”,避免因误用旧版图标引发UI异常。 资源复用效率由此显著提升。团队可基于链上不可篡改的资源谱系,一键追溯某按钮组件自v1.2.0起所有迭代记录、关联PR、测试覆盖率及接入项目清单。新成员入职后,无需翻查零散文档或询问同事,直接通过链浏览器查看“该TabBar组件是否已适配Android 14无障碍API”,点击即可跳转至对应代码仓库与验证用例。资源不再是孤立资产,而成为带上下文、可验证、可溯源的活数据节点。
AI生成结论图,仅供参考 更关键的是,它重构了跨职能协作的信任基础。市场部提出紧急上线新版启动页,需同步更新App内多处引导图。以往靠人工对齐路径易遗漏,现只需在资源管理后台提交变更提案,经产品、设计、安卓三方链上签名确认后,CI/CD流水线自动拉取最新资源包、触发全量UI快照比对,并生成差异报告。整个过程留痕可审计,责任清晰,无需会议协调或临时群消息确认。 实际落地中,某电商App团队引入该方案后,资源相关Bug下降67%,UI回归测试耗时减少42%,跨端组件复用率从31%升至79%。技术选型聚焦轻量化:采用Hyperledger Fabric精简版作为底层,配合自研Gradle插件与Webhook网关,全程不侵入业务代码,平均接入周期仅3人日。区块链在此并非炫技,而是将“谁改了什么、何时生效、是否可信”这些本该透明的信息,从经验依赖转化为机器可读、可执行的基础设施。 效能跃升的本质,是让开发者从资源救火员回归为功能创造者。当切图、组件、配置不再需要反复核对、手动搬运、口头约定,工程师便能专注在真正差异化的业务逻辑与用户体验优化上。区块链工具链的价值,正在于以最小侵入方式,为Android生态装上一套沉默却可靠的“资源交通管制系统”。 (编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

